Ok…I’m not trying to create an animation of someone slurping spaghetti, but I imagine the method is the same. I’m researching a way to get an animated flowy ribbon to get sucked into a box. It will be flying around a room for a bit and then end up getting sucked into a box that will be moving as well. I was wondering if anybody had any method that would work best for this!? The ribbon will have a life of it’s own that I’ll have to probably have animation control over it while it’s dynamic, but I figure I can use the dynamic joint chain with maya hair to animate that unless it interferes with whatever method I’ll need to have it get sucked in…Any ideas!? nCloth plane (being wrap deformer of the ribbon, or the ribbon itself) pulled by transform constraints into the box.


#3

You might also want to place a volume axis field at the opening of the box to provide a continous inward push into the box. Thus once the tip of the ribbon was pulled into the box the rest would get sucked in, even if it was a small box.
